**Vendor note: Inkmill markdown pipeline**

Rendering for Parchway docs is outsourced to Inkmill under an annual contract, renewing each March. They handle sanitization and PDF export; we own the upload queue. SLA: 4-hour response on rendering failures. Escalate only after two failed retries. Their support desk is reachable at the address below.

billing contact of hahaf-baguf = zorael.tammir.jorius@sivrelhq.internal

During the Quillbrook 4.2 release, the CacheWeave layer served stale responses for roughly forty minutes because invalidation events from the Lanternfold API were dropped when the queue overflowed. We have since added a TTL floor and a forced-purge endpoint. To verify the fix against staging, call the purge endpoint authenticated with the credential below.

API key for kafop-fafof: qvz3-4pw

Team,

The Ledgerglass audit-log viewer finished its cut-over to the Fenwick cluster last night. All historical entries were re-indexed and spot-checked against the old store; counts matched exactly across every tenant. Retention enforcement now runs hourly instead of nightly, so expect the viewer to show trims sooner. The legacy instance stays read-only for thirty days, then gets decommissioned. For anyone touching this service later, the production configuration that went live with the cut-over is recorded below.

service settings:
[briius]
port = 3000
region = outer-1
host = briius.zarqeldyn.internal
team = wenael
timeout_ms = 2000
retries = 5

Weekly eng sync — fonts. Decision: vendor all third-party fonts into the Larkspool repo instead of pulling from the Glyphden CDN at build time. Licensing review done; only the two Quintero families need attribution files. Build size impact ~1.2 MB, acceptable. Action: strip unused weights before merge. Owner for the vendoring PR and license audit is named below.

account owner for bawip-tahag: Raleth Quenok